PHP 的 RPC 框架 Dora RPC
- 授权协议: MIT
- 开发语言: PHP
- 操作系统: 跨平台
- 软件首页: https://github.com/xcl3721/Dora-RPC
- 软件文档: https://github.com/xcl3721/Dora-RPC
软件介绍
Dora RPC 是一款基础于Swoole定长包头通讯协议的最精简的RPC。
此RPC基础于Swoole定长包头通讯协议的最精简的RPC
支持并发\单调,异步\同步
目前只提供PHP语言版本,后续还会根据使用建议逐渐迭代
可以很方便快速的搭建后端应用服务器
此开源用于快速实现RPC的基础,根据需要进行调配,用于PHP前后端服务器间RPC
后续将配套中间件及服务降级
基础swoole,性能较好可供大中型网站使用
客户端代码:
$obj = new DoraRPCClient();
for ($i = 0; $i < 100000; $i++) {
#single
$ret = $obj->singleAPI("abc", array(234, $i), true);
var_dump($ret);
#multi
$data = array(
"oak" => array("name" => "oakdf", "param" => array("dsaf" => "321321")),
"cd" => array("name" => "oakdfff", "param" => array("codo" => "fds")),
);
$ret = $obj->multiAPI($data, false);
var_dump($ret);
}服务器端:
$server = new DoraRPCServer();//这里必须是DoraRPCServer继承类并实现dowork才可以工作
Spark大数据分析技术与实战
董轶群、曹正凤、赵仁乾、王安 / 电子工业出版社 / 2017-7 / 59.00
Spark作为下一代大数据处理引擎,经过短短几年的飞跃式发展,正在以燎原之势席卷业界,现已成为大数据产业中的一股中坚力量。 《Spark大数据分析技术与实战》着重讲解了Spark内核、Spark GraphX、Spark SQL、Spark Streaming和Spark MLlib的核心概念与理论框架,并提供了相应的示例与解析。 《Spark大数据分析技术与实战》共分为8章,其中前4......一起来看看 《Spark大数据分析技术与实战》 这本书的介绍吧!
